CVE-2026-20212
A vulnerability in the Silicon One integration for Cisco Nexus 9000 Series Switches could allow an unauthenticated, remote attacker to execute code with root privileges. This vulnerability exists because TCP ports 43210 and 43211 are accessible in the default Layer 3 (L3) virtual routing and forwarding (VRF). A successful exploit could allow the attacker to connect to an affected device and send crafted input that could be executed as code with root privileges. The exploitation of this vulnerability could also cause the S1HAL process to crash, which could cause the device to reload.
